The Central Government has said in the Parliament today that the production of coal in the country will increase further by next year and the demand for coal will also increase 90 will be crore tonnes. Coal Minister Prahlad Joshi told in the Rajya Sabha that the production of coal in the country will increase to one billion tonnes by next year. He told that the demand of coal is continuously increasing in the country, in such a situation there is a dire need to increase its production. It may be noted that on one hand the government is talking about increasing the production of coal in the country, while on the other hand the government has passed the 'Energy Conservation (Amendment) Bill, 2020' has been approved. Many provisions have been made in this bill to promote renewable energy and the government has called it a step towards the future. Protecting the environment is the responsibility of both the Center and the States. That's why both the central and state governments will have to take strong steps in this direction. The specialty of the Energy Conservation Bill is that it talks about the use of non-fossil sources including green hydrogen, green ammonia, biomass and ethanol to meet energy needs. Along with this, a provision has also been made in this bill that big buildings which require Kilowatts should insist on meeting their needs through renewable energy.
